What is the term for the process of finding and completely extinguishing any remaining

pockets of fire?


A. Salvage


B. Overhaul


C. Mop-up


D. Investigation—ANSWER-B. overhaul


Who first developed the RECEO tactical model?


A. Lloyd Layman


B. Alan Brunacini


C. John Norman


D. James Smith—ANSWER-A. Lloyd Layman


Which hose diameter is used as both supply line and attack handline?


A. 1in 3/4" (45mm)


B. 2in 1/2" (65mm)

,C. 2in 3/4" (70mm)


D. 3in" (76mm)—ANSWER-B. 2in 1/2" (65mm)


In general, what volume does a 2 and 1/2 (65mm) handline flow?


A. 175 GPM


B. 200 GPM


C. 250 GPM


D. 300 GPM—ANSWER-C. 250 GPM


a 50' (15 M) section of charged 2 and 1/2" hose weighs approximately:


A. 100 lbs


B. 125 lbs


C. 140 lbs


D. 200 lbs—ANSWER-C. 140lbs
